Automation World Feature: Siemens Robot Safety Blueprint

In a recent Automation World article featuring Siemens experts, hear how manufacturers must navigate a landscape of emerging technologies to yield higher efficiency and scalability, but with their adoption of new technologies comes a crucial responsibility: ensuring safety. Successful implementation requires more than compliance — it demands strategic planning, digital simulation tools, and ongoing monitoring. With advancements in advanced 3D manufacturing simulation software and digital twin technology, companies now have powerful solutions at their disposal to mitigate risks while optimizing efficiency.
